perf probe: Show correct source lines of probes on kmodules



Perf probe always failed to find appropriate line numbers because of
failing to find .text start address offset from debuginfo.

e.g.
  ----
  # ./perf probe -m pcspkr pcspkr_event:5
  Added new events:
    probe:pcspkr_event   (on pcspkr_event:5 in pcspkr)
    probe:pcspkr_event_1 (on pcspkr_event:5 in pcspkr)

  You can now use it in all perf tools, such as:

          perf record -e probe:pcspkr_event_1 -aR sleep 1

  # ./perf probe -l
  Failed to find debug information for address ffffffffa031f006
  Failed to find debug information for address ffffffffa031f016
    probe:pcspkr_event   (on pcspkr_event+6 in pcspkr)
    probe:pcspkr_event_1 (on pcspkr_event+22 in pcspkr)
  ----

This fixes the above issue as below.
1. Get the relative address of the symbol in .text by using
   map->start.
2. Adjust the address by adding the offset of .text section
   in the kernel module binary.

With this fix, perf probe -l shows lines correctly.
  ----
  # ./perf probe -l
    probe:pcspkr_event   (on pcspkr_event:5@drivers/input/misc/pcspkr.c in pcspkr)
    probe:pcspkr_event_1 (on pcspkr_event:5@drivers/input/misc/pcspkr.c in pcspkr)
  ----
